Variable Induction Control Valve: Description and Operation
The SRV system operates under WOT conditions
above 5000 rpm to maximize engine performance. When actuated by the PCM, the SRV solenoid energizes, allowing mechanical linkage to redirect the intake air flow to six short runners. The PCM looks for a current spike when actuating the
solenoid. If the spike is not present, the PCM sets the DTC.
